The Eagles open season at Leo, shoot 485

The lady Eagle golf team kicked off their 2012 campaign with an expected start.  The team, which is largely inexperienced, shot a 485 en route to a last place finish at the Leo Lions Invitational.  The tournament was won by two-time state champion Hamilton Southeastern.  Leading Fremont was Alivia Behnfeldt with a 98.  Jessica Mofield followed up with a 121, Lexi Skeens shot 125 in her first varsity match, and Courtney Hayes  had a 141, also in her first varsity match.  The team will now look to work on their games to bounce back from this tough start.  The team will be back in action on Tuesday at Fairfield.  Good luck ladies.
